Speculative Loading in WordPress
The WordPress Performance Team recently published a new plugin called “Speculative Loading” which enables a new technology of the same name to automatically prerender certain URLs on the page, which can lead to near-instant page load times. The functionality is powered by the Speculation Rules API, a new web API that allows defining rules for which kinds of URLs to prefetch or prerender.
Is It Time to Switch? Why Enterprises Migrate from Drupal to WordPress
Managing a Drupal site is often complex, requiring careful consideration for even minor tweaks or updates. That’s because Drupal caters to “ambitious site builders” – developers and technical teams with immense knowledge of how a website is built. WordPress, with its easy-to-use interface and robust out-of-the-box functionality, "democratizes publishing" by empowering users to create, manage and publish content with ease.
